Work Hard Be Nice

The Knowledge is Power Program, commonly known as KIPP, is a network of free open-enrollment college-preparatory schools in low income communities throughout the United States. Their motto – Work Hard. Be Nice. I think we can look at that as a positioning statement for our school. KIPP schools work from 8 to 8. Had asked … Read more

Waldorf Schools

Pune’s Waldorf School, Swadha, was started by Shefali in 2012. One of the main ways of marketing the school is through parent presentations. I attended one recently along with 8 other parents. Most of them had heard about the school through a friend. Almost all of them had visited the School website – swadhaschool.org. There … Read more
